A serious crash has closed part of the A66 near to Stainton, Penrith.

Police have closed the road between Penruddock and Rheged while they are dealing with the "serious road traffic collision on the A66 near to Stainton, Penrith."

Motorists are being advised to find an alternative route.

Cumbria Police have said that the road could be closed for some time.

A spokesman posted on social media: "Highways England are now implementing road closures at Penruddock and Rheged, the road will be closed for some time and we are advising people to avoid the area if possible."
